171 Cedar Art Center’s Houghton Gallery seeks to present visual art exhibitions of unique vision and sound intellectual premise. Artists are selected for exhibitions based on overall artistic integrity and how the subject, medium or curatorial content fits in with exhibit and program plans each year.

Annually a Review Panel of qualified art professionals from outside of the organization reviews submissions and makes recommendations for upcoming exhibitions. 171's Visual Arts Curator coordinates the exhibition schedule and may select additional artists to participate in order to facilitate a well rounded exhibition program. While artists are primarily chosen through the annual review process artists are also selected from past submissions that have been kept on file, studio and gallery visits, referrals, artist web sites, and ongoing research. In addition the Houghton Gallery occasionally works with guest curators.

We generally schedule exhibitions 18 - 24 months in advance.

(A note to artists who have previously shown at 171: Artists who have had solo exhibition in the past 8 years or been included a two or a three person exhibition in the 5 years will not be selected for a solo exhibition.  Contact us if you have questions about eligibility.)

   

Submissions: To be considered for exhibition in 171 Cedar Arts Center’s Houghton Gallery submit the following materials for review:

1. Letter of interest

2. 8-10 Digital Images on CD (recommended) or 8-10 Slides, labeled, in slide sheet.

3. List of Images with title, dimensions, medium and date of each work

4. Resume or C.V.

5. Artist's Statement

(There may be some variation for curatorial proposals. Please contact Ann Welles for further details.)

Further Description of Submission Materials: Put name & contact information are on all materials
 

1. Letter of interest:

Introduce yourself, tell us how you know about Houghton Gallery and explain what you envision (for example, ‘an exhibition of my recent paintings’).  Briefly tell us what our audience would gain from experiencing your work. Let us know if you have a website or if there is a place online we can see your recent work.

2. 8-10 Images: Please submit recent work.  Images will not be accepted via email.

CD’s - JPEGs or PDFs recommended.  Label CD with name and contact information.

Keep image size reasonable.  Be sure files will open on a PC.

File names should include the number of the image as it appears on your separate List of Images.

Slides - label slides with your name, which side is up, and a numbers coordinating with the numbers on your List of Images. Put slides in a slide sheet.

3. List of Images: A numbered list that coordinates with the images you have submitted. Include title, dimensions, medium and year of each artwork

4. Resume or C.V.

5. Statement:  one page artist’s statement or essay about a curatorial proposition.

You may submit additional materials such as reviews or promotional materials, if they lend insight into your work. 

 

Remember materials will not be returned to you.
